WebIn order to simplify any fraction, our Fraction Simplifier will calculate the greatest common divisor (GCD), also known as the greatest common factor (GCF), or the highest common factor (HCF) of numerator and denominator that you entered. Then, fraction simplifier calculator will divide the numerator and denominator of the fraction by this number. WebThe simplest form of 143 / 52 is 11 / 4. Steps to simplifying fractions. Find the GCD (or HCF) of numerator and denominator GCD of 143 and 52 is 13; Divide both the numerator and denominator by the GCD 143 ÷ 13 / 52 ÷ 13; Reduced fraction: 11 / 4 Therefore, 143/52 simplified to lowest terms is 11/4.
